火电厂尿素水解产品气输送问题分析

Abstract:

针对尿素水解产品气输送过程中存在的蒸汽回凝、氨基甲酸铵结晶析出等问题,分析了给料尿素溶液质量分数和水解反应器运行压力对产品气成分、蒸汽回凝温度和氨基甲酸铵结晶析出温度的影响。结果表明:蒸汽回凝温度和氨基甲酸铵结晶析出温度由给料尿素溶液质量分数和水解反应器运行压力决定;当运行压力0.7mpa,给料溶液质量分数为50%时,产品气中水蒸气的回凝温度为133℃,氨基甲酸铵的结晶析出温度为85℃。并建议在设计伴热管道保温时,选用硬质或半硬质圆形保温材料,根据允许最大散热损失小于104w/m2,计算保温层厚度。
